Every learner possesses a unique talents that shape their strategy to information absorption. By understanding the VARK learning styles – Visual, Auditory, Read/Write, and Kinesthetic – educators can tailor teaching methods to meet individual needs. This personalized framework unlocks each student's potential by catering to their preferred modes of learning.
Visual learners thrive when presented with diagrams, images, and visualizations, while auditory learners benefit knowledge through lectures, discussions, and audio materials. Those who learn best through Read/Write prefer printed information, engaging with articles. Kinesthetic learners show their understanding through hands-on activities, experiments, and applied experiences.
